Fake iPhone Gas Stoves Seized in China

Inside the boxes, there H25 com สล็อต were gas range stoves with Apple’s iconic logo, Apple written in Chinese, and “iPhone” branded on them. The stoves had tags that said they passed inspection. The tags, like the stoves, were apparently fakes. It wasn’t just phony merch; the stoves also had defects with their safety switches. According to Chinese news site Sina, authorities confiscated 681 gas stoves. The Apple and iPhone logos have been slapped on all sorts of goods in China, from copycat electronics to even sneakers.
